Premium member Presentation Transcript PowerPoint Presentation: Strange LandscapesPowerPoint Presentation: Arizona, USA – The Wave (stunning sandstone rock formation that is around 190 million years old and looks unreal)PowerPoint Presentation: Tasmania – The Tessellated Pavement (very straight rectangles that are a natural phenomenon)PowerPoint Presentation: Egypt – White Desert (strange rock formations formed by sandstorms)PowerPoint Presentation: Japan - Blood Pond Hot Spring (that’s how it got it’s name)PowerPoint Presentation: Northern Ireland – Giant’s Causeway (mystical rock formation)PowerPoint Presentation: Bolivia – Salar de Uyuni (world’s largest salt flats)PowerPoint Presentation: China – The Stone Forest (a 400-square-kilometre stone wonderland)PowerPoint Presentation: Antarctica – McMurdo Dry Valleys (Iron oxides stain the snout of the Taylor Glacier forming a feature commonly referred to as Blood Falls)PowerPoint Presentation: Canada - Spotted Lake (one of the world's highest concentration of minerals)PowerPoint Presentation: Nevada, USA – The Black Rock Desert (a dry lake bed)PowerPoint Presentation: California - Crystal Cave (made from marble)PowerPoint Presentation: Western Australia - Bungle Bungles are an amazing rock formation.PowerPoint Presentation: Alaska - Steam rises from the top vent in the summit crater of Mount Redoubt.PowerPoint Presentation: Cappadocia, Turkey - is home to many underground and above ground cities.PowerPoint Presentation: Dominica - The Boiling Lake at the Caribbean island bubbles with blue-grey water.PowerPoint Presentation: Spain - The blood red Rio Tinto riverPowerPoint Presentation: Brazil - Vale de Luna or "the valley of the moon“ (an ancient plateau thought to be over 1.8 billion years old)PowerPoint Presentation: THE END Click to exit You do not have the permission to view this presentation.
